How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    GIS Consultant

    £35k (DOE)

    Manchester

    As GIS Consultant you'll support a wide range of projects, scoping GIS requirements and maintaining datasets while ensuring data quality throughout. You will also design and communicate innovative GIS solutions aligned with client objectives, deliver training and provide ongoing technical support.

    What's in it for you?

    Salary up to £35k (DOE)
    Holiday entitlement: 24 days annual leave plus Bank Holidays
    Professional development: Paid professional memberships
    Training budget and opportunities to upskill
    Bonus schemeThe Role

    You'll be responsible for providing technical GIS expertise across multi-disciplines supporting multiple projects.

    Your work will include:

    Scope GIS requirements at project quotation stage
    Manage and maintain GIS datasets, including ArcGIS Online
    Extract, transform, and integrate CAD and 3D data into GIS formats
    Conduct spatial and temporal data analysis, including processing and analysis using Excel
    Deliver high-quality GIS outputs including spatial analysis, advanced digitisation, data capture, data management, and geoprocessing
    Develop, implement, and promote GIS workflows, standards, and integrated solutions
    Ensure data quality through rigorous validation, quality assurance, and adherence to internal standards
    Manage GIS software, licences, and supplier relationships
    Research, evaluate, and recommend new GIS technologies and applications to support innovationAbout You

    Proficiency in QGIS, ArcGIS Pro/ArcMap, and ArcGIS Online
    Solid understanding of spatial data formats and GIS principles
    Ability to integrate CAD data into GIS environments
    Proactive, solutions-focused mindset with strong problem-solving ability
    Ability to work both independently and collaboratively within a team
    Enthusiasm for GIS, environmental issues, and emerging technologiesWhat's Next?
